Earlier this year, Realme launched its mid-range smartphone — Realme 10 in India. The company has now released an OTA update for the smartphone. The company claims that the smartphone update will offer several new features, optimized network compatibility, and will provide system stability.
The OTA update is being rolled out in phases, with users receiving a push message to download it. The upgrade will be rolled out to a select group of users today, with a wider distribution following in a few days. Alternatively, it can also be checked by going to Settings > About Phone > System update.
“The update reaffirms realme's commitment to providing regular and timely updates to its devices. Continuing the trend, realme 10 launched in January 2023 is now fetching the March OTA Changelog update,” said the company in a statement.
Here’s the complete change log for the update
UI Version: RMX3630_11.A.29
Security
● Updates Android security patch: February, 2023
Camera
● Optimizes the shooting effect of the front and rear camera
System
● Optimizes the probabilistic lagging issue in calls and other scenarios
Realme 10 specifications
Realme 10 comes with a 6.4-inch AMOLED panel with an 84.4% screen-to-body ratio. The display supports a 90Hz refresh rate and maximum 360Hz touch sampling rate.
The smartphone comes with a dual rear camera setup comprising a 50MP AI primary sensor and a 2MP B&W sensor. The front houses a 16MP selfie sensor for selfies and video calls. The camera supports photography functions like Video, Night Mode, Panoramic view, Expert, Timelapse, Portrait Mode, HDR, Ultra macro, AI Beauty, Filter, Super Text, and Slow Motion.
The smartphone comes in two RAM and storage options – 4GB+64GB and 8GB+128GB. The smartphone comes with dynamic RAM up to 8GB that converts storage into virtual RAM to create more storage.
Realme 10 comes powered by the MediaTek Helio G99 processor and features an octa-core CPU with two high performance Arm Cortex-A76 processors clocking up to 2.2GHz speed. The device runs Realme UI 3.0 UI based on Android 12 operating system. For audio purposes, the phone features UltraBoom speakers that come with Hi-Res dual certification.
The smartphone is backed by a 5000mAh battery and 33W SuperVOOC charging support. The company claims to offer more than 30 hours of battery life for phone calls and 50 plus hours for music streaming.
